djangoにアクセスできなかった時のメモ。 dockerでdjango用コンテナを作成したのに、pcからアクセスできなかった python manage.py runserver だけだとpcのブラウザからでアクセスできない django django

djangoにアクセスできなかった時のメモ。
dockerでdjango用コンテナを作成したのに、pcからアクセスできなかった
python manage.py runserver
だけだとpcのブラウザからでアクセスできない。
起動はするし同じコンテナ内からだと wget 127.0.0.1 はできるのだが。
pcから http://localhost:ポート番号/ だとアクセスできな

  2023-01-29 21:09:00

pythonでコマンドを実行し結果を返値で取得 python python

pythonでコマンドを実行し結果を返値で取得

import subprocess

r=subprocess.run("ls", capture_output=True, text=True).stdout
# Python 3.7以降限定 capture_output=True , Python 3.6以前は代わりにstdout=subprocess.PIPE と stderr

  2023-01-28 01:43:59

bash sh で実行すると Syntax error: "(" unexpected のエラーがでる bash bash

bash sh で実行すると Syntax error: "(" unexpected のエラーがでる

・エラーになった内奥
# sh hoge1.sh
Syntax error: "(" unexpected

・エラーだったのが箇所
function log () {

・解決策
chmod +x hoge1.sh

・次からはこちらで実行
./hoge1.sh

  2023-01-25 10:47:10

postgresql インストール時にエラー発生 Failed to fetch debian postgresql postgresql .deb 404 Not Found [IP: postgresql postgresql

Failed to fetch debian postgresql postgresql .deb 404 Not Found [IP:

■実行コマンド
RUN apt-get -y install postgresql
・・・省略
#0 486.0 Fetched 45.7 MB in 8min 4s (94.5 kB/s)
#0 486.0 E: Failed to fet

  2023-01-19 12:00:25

Pythonでは文字列や数値の右にゼロを詰める(ゼロパディング)する場合、zfill関数を使うと便利 python python

Pythonでは文字列や数値の右にゼロを詰める(ゼロパディング)する場合、zfill関数を使うと便利

例)
s = "c"
print( s.zfill( 2 ))
print( s.zfill( 8 ))

#0c
#0000000c

  2023-01-11 21:33:48

windows環境でminikubeを使用し、windows内のファイルとpod内のファイルを共有させ、ブラウザで内容を確認するまでにやった作業 minikube minikube

windows環境でminikubeを使用し、windows内のファイルとpod内のファイルを共有させ、ブラウザで内容を確認するまでにやった作業とファイル

ファイルを
windowsフォルダ:C:\work\minikubedemo1 内に設置し。これが

minikube: /mnt/minikubedemo1 を経由して

pod: /usr/share/nginx/htm

  2022-12-27 15:08:55

minikubeのwindows版をダウンロードして実行すると以下のエラー DRV_DOCKER_NOT_RUNNING が原因で終了します: docker が見つかりましたが、docker サービスが稼働していません。docker サービスを再起動してみてください minikube minikube

minikubeのwindows版をダウンロードして実行すると以下のエラー。
既存のdockerが動いていたのがよくなかったみたい。
docker wdesktopを再起動したら以下のエラーはでなくなったよ

# minikube start
  デフォルトドライバーを採用できませんでした。こちらが可能性の高い順に考えられる事です:
▪ docker: Not healthy

  2022-12-23 12:05:12

VirtualBoxにLinuxをインストールして、「Guest Additions」のインストール VirtualBox VirtualBox

VirtualBoxにLinuxをインストールして、「Guest Additions」のインストールする。
これで、マウスの切り替えがスムーズになったり、
ホストOSとゲストOSでクリップボードが共有できたり、
ファイルの共有が可能になる。
最初にこれいれないと、使いにくいよね

---------------
Guest Additions インストール

1 ゲストOSのUb

  2022-12-23 12:01:29

minikubeでのNodePortへのアクセスして、ブラウザで確認するまで minikub kubernetes

minikubeでのNodePortへのアクセスして、ブラウザで確認するまで
ちなみに環境はwindows

minikubeでは minikube service コマンドにService名を渡すとNodePortで公開されているServiceのURLを組み立てて表示してくれる
kubernetes の podつくってそれに serviceつくって、ブラウザからアクセスできるようにする

  2022-12-16 22:26:57

minikubeのwindows版をダウンロードして実行するとエラー。 DRV_DOCKER_NOT_RUNNING が原因で終了します kubernetes kubernetes

minikubeのwindows版をダウンロードして実行すると以下のエラー。
既存のdockerが動いていたのがよくなかったみたい。
docker desktopを再起動したら以下のエラーはでなくなったよ

# minikube start
  デフォルトドライバーを採用できませんでした。こちらが可能性の高い順に考えられる事です:
▪ docker: Not healthy:

  2022-12-13 00:12:11